Afficher le résulta uniquement si celui-ci est négaif (Tableur OpenOffice)

Messages postés
7
Date d'inscription
mercredi 20 novembre 2019
Statut
Membre
Dernière intervention
25 novembre 2019
- - Dernière réponse :  eugene - 25 nov. 2019 à 17:35
Bonjour à tous et à toutes
Je rencontre un problème que je tourne dans tous les sens sans parvenir à le résoudre

Dans la cellule E13 je veux que le résultat du calcule suivant ((F9-E9)-(I9-H9) s'affiche uniquement si le résultat est inférieur à 0

Idem pour la cellule F13 mais uniquement si le résultat est supérieur à 0

de plus est il possible de demander à ce qu'une colonne soit négative ? Je m'explique si je tape 100, cette valeur peut elle devenir -100 automatiquement ?

Je vous remercie par avance de l'aide que vous voudrez bien m'apporter

Afficher la suite 

11 réponses

Messages postés
50476
Date d'inscription
lundi 13 août 2007
Statut
Contributeur
Dernière intervention
6 décembre 2019
11384
0
Merci
Bonjour Marie.

Tu poses des questions assez curieuses !
Ta formule ((F9-E9)-(I9-H9)) s'écrit tout simplement F9-E9-I9+H9 ; sans aucune parenthèse ...
Pour n'afficher le résultat que s'il est négatif, la formule sera =SI(F9-E9-I9+H9<0;0;F9-E9-I9+H9).
Et si tu écris 100, le logiciel ne peut afficher que 100 ! Tu peux bien sûr créer une macro, si tu connais le VBA de Libre Office (différent de celui d'Excel) ; mais c'est quand même plus simple de :
. saisir tes nombres négatifs comme tout le monde, en commençant par le signe moins ;
. ou alors saisir tes nombres en colonne Z, et dans ta colonne négative mettre la formule =-Z:Z ;
. ou continuer comme tu as commencé, en mettant des + et ses - dans tes opérations ...

P.S. Tu as vu qu'il y a un décalage dans tes numéros de ligne ? Il n'y a que dalle en E13 et F13 !!!
Commenter la réponse de Raymond PENTIER
Messages postés
7
Date d'inscription
mercredi 20 novembre 2019
Statut
Membre
Dernière intervention
25 novembre 2019
0
Merci
bonjour,
merci beaucoup pour cette réponse qui ne correspondait pas tout à fait à ce que j'attendais mais en m'en inspirant tout fonctionne très bien
Un immanence merci cela faisait plusieurs années que je bidouillais pour avoir des résultats corrects et maintenant c'est génial tout fonctionne à merveille.
PS dans la ligne 13 il y a une formule cachée. Mais toujours en m'inspirant de votre formule j'ai pu l'éliminer et enrichir la formule de base
Raymond PENTIER
Messages postés
50476
Date d'inscription
lundi 13 août 2007
Statut
Contributeur
Dernière intervention
6 décembre 2019
11384 -
Eh bien tant mieux si tu as réglé ton problème ...
- Dommage que n'ayons pas eu accès à ton fichier, dont on n'a vu qu'une photo, et que nous ne sachions pas non plus quel est ton résultat final.
Je reste à ta disposition.
Cordialement.
Commenter la réponse de MARIE0191
Messages postés
7
Date d'inscription
mercredi 20 novembre 2019
Statut
Membre
Dernière intervention
25 novembre 2019
0
Merci
Bonjour,
après plusieurs tests je me rends compte que ça ne fonctionne pas si bien que ça.

en effet je souhaite que dans la cellule F12 ne s'affiche le résultat que si celui-ci est positif. Idem dans la cellule E12 mais pour un résultat négatif

PS : je ne veux pas taper "-" quand je saisie le montant d'une dépense.

Commenter la réponse de MARIE0191
Messages postés
50476
Date d'inscription
lundi 13 août 2007
Statut
Contributeur
Dernière intervention
6 décembre 2019
11384
0
Merci
Dans mon premier message, je t'ai mis une formule avec le
 nombre 0
; tu as décidé de le remplacer par le
 texte ""
: Impossible de faire la moindre opération avec un texte ...

En F12 ce sera =SI(F7-E7<0;0;F7-E7)
En G12 ce sera =SI(F7-E7>0;F7-E7;0)

"PS : je ne veux pas taper "-" quand je saisie le montant d'une dépense."
Il ne faut surtout pas mettre les dépenses avec un signe moins, parce qu'ensuite tu fais la différence Crédits-Débits, et 400-(-150) te donnerait 550 au lieu de 250 !

Au lieu d'envoyer des photos figées, ce serait infiniment mieux d'envoyer le fichier Excel, sur lequel on pourrait faire des vérifications et des essais ...
 1) Tu vas dans http://cjoint.com/ 
2) Tu cliques sur [Parcourir] pour sélectionner ton fichier (15 Mo maxi)
3) Tu défiles vers le bas pour cliquer sur le bouton bleu [Créer le lien Cjoint]
4) Au bout de quelques secondes la deuxième page s'affiche, avec le lien en gras ; tu fais un clic-droit dessus et tu choisis "Copier le lien"
5) Tu reviens dans ta discussion sur CCM, et dans ton message tu fais "Coller".
=>Voir la fiche http://www.commentcamarche.net/faq/29493-utiliser-cjoint
Il existe aussi :
1) https://mon-partage.fr/
2) https://www.transfernow.net/
Commenter la réponse de Raymond PENTIER
Messages postés
7
Date d'inscription
mercredi 20 novembre 2019
Statut
Membre
Dernière intervention
25 novembre 2019
0
Merci
bonjour,
je vais tenter de copier le lien
https://www.cjoint.com/c/IKxpdBDSLW2

Merci de me dire si cela fonctionne
Commenter la réponse de MARIE0191
Messages postés
50476
Date d'inscription
lundi 13 août 2007
Statut
Contributeur
Dernière intervention
6 décembre 2019
11384
0
Merci
Bien sûr, que ça fonctionne !

Question : Es-tu certaine que tu commences tes comptes avec un déficit de 1 000 € ?
C'est le montant que tu as mis en H2, solde au 1er janvier !
Commenter la réponse de Raymond PENTIER
Messages postés
7
Date d'inscription
mercredi 20 novembre 2019
Statut
Membre
Dernière intervention
25 novembre 2019
0
Merci
Bonjour
peut importe puis ce que je teste avec déficit et sans déficit
(Eh oui je commence souvent avec un découvert mais jamais 1000€ heureusement !)
Commenter la réponse de MARIE0191
Messages postés
50476
Date d'inscription
lundi 13 août 2007
Statut
Contributeur
Dernière intervention
6 décembre 2019
11384
0
Merci
Parfait !

- Première manipulation, remplacer "" par 0 dans les cellules E10, F10, E12 et F12 de toutes les feuilles.

- Deuxième manipulation, pourquoi les valeurs en E2:E8 sont-elles positives tandis que la valeur en E10 devient négative ? Un débit négatif est un crédit !
En E10 saisir la formule =SI(E8>F8;E8-F8;0).
En F10 saisir la formule =SI(F8>E8;F8-E8;0).

- Troisième manipulation, en feuille FEVRI, préciser en D2 "fin JANVIER".
En E2 saisir la formule =JANV!E12 et en F2 la formule =JANV!F12.

- Quatrième manipulation : pour la ligne 12, j'y reviendrai quand tu m'auras expliqué ce que la valeur en I8 vient faire là, puisque ce sont des entrées prévues, donc non enregistrées ...
Commenter la réponse de Raymond PENTIER
Messages postés
7
Date d'inscription
mercredi 20 novembre 2019
Statut
Membre
Dernière intervention
25 novembre 2019
0
Merci
bonjour,
j'ai fait toutes les manipulations indiquées
La colonne I est très importante pour moi.
Elle me sert en enregistrer les entrées prévues et quand elle sont créditées par la banque je mets OK dans la ligne concernée de la colonne I.
Mon problème est que je n'arrive pas à avoir un résultat correcte dans la ligne 12

https://www.cjoint.com/c/IKykaD6LDx2
Raymond PENTIER
Messages postés
50476
Date d'inscription
lundi 13 août 2007
Statut
Contributeur
Dernière intervention
6 décembre 2019
11384 -
Alors je ne peux pas t'aider, car je n'ai jamais raisonné de cette façon avec des écritures bancaires ...
Commenter la réponse de MARIE0191
Messages postés
7
Date d'inscription
mercredi 20 novembre 2019
Statut
Membre
Dernière intervention
25 novembre 2019
0
Merci
bonjour,
c'est pas grave j'ai enfin fini par trouver la solution
je tiens néanmoins à vous remercier pour votre aide et votre patience.
bien cordialement
Marie
Commenter la réponse de MARIE0191
0
Merci
Bonsoir,
Avez vous essayé des logiciels de gestion de budget ? Il y en a de nombreux, généralement bien faits et souvent gratuit...
Cordialement,
Commenter la réponse de eugene